The Best Month to Visit Cameroon

The Best Month to Visit Cameroon

Cameroon’s climate is characterised by four distinct seasons, each with its own peculiarities.

  • Spring (March to May) in Cameroon begins with higher temperatures and more rainfall. The average temperature during this period is around +28 °C and rainfall can reach 200-300 mm per month. Meanwhile, this time of year is ideal for lovers of outdoor activities, as the weather is conducive to travelling and sightseeing.
  • Summer (June to August) in Cameroon is hot and humid. The average temperature reaches its maximum and is around +32 °C. Rainfall also increases, reaching 300-400 mm per month. This time of year is best spent in the shade or under a roof, avoiding prolonged exposure to the sun. And this advice is among the most important facts about Cameroon.
  • Autumn (September to November) in Cameroon is characterised by lower temperatures and less rainfall. The average temperature drops to +28 °C and rainfall drops to 100-200 mm per month. By the way, this time of year is ideal for visiting national parks and reserves, as the weather becomes more comfortable for long walks outdoors.
  • Winter (December to February) in Cameroon is dry and cool. The average temperature is around +25 °C and rainfall is minimal. Meanwhile, this time of year is ideal for visiting cultural attractions and experiencing the local culture.

Also, it is important to note that the best month to visit Cameroon regions is November. As this is the most interesting time to observe animals in Waza National Park or Korup National Park. And the weather is most favourable.

Local Currency & Where to Change Money in Cameroon 

The CFA franc is the official currency of Cameroon. It is notable because its name is derived from the French expression “Communaute Financiere Africaine”. This is a reference to facts about Cameroon and reflects the country’s historical connection with France. By the way, it is one of the few currencies in the world whose name is linked to an international organisation.

Meanwhile, it is possible to change currency in Cameroon favourably at banks and Express Exchange offices. Banks often offer the best rate. However, they may charge a commission for transactions. In contrast, currency exchange centres are often more affordable. But their exchange rates are less favourable. Therefore, it is important to check the exchange rate before exchanging. Also, avoid exchanging on the street to avoid becoming a victim of fraud.

Meanwhile, in Cameroon, locals practically do not accept bank cards to pay for goods and services. Therefore, most transactions are done in cash. If you are planning a trip to Cameroon, bet on cash.

3 Wonderful Places to Visit in Cameroon 

  1. A lake obtained in the crater of a volcano. Nyos is known for its unique natural phenomenon. At the end of the 20th century, there was a limnic eruption here. And it became a real catastrophe. Now the lake is an object of scientific interest and attracts tourists with its unusual history.
  2. Faunistic Reserve Jha. It is home to many rare and endangered species of animals. For instance, such as forest elephants, gorillas and chimpanzees. This famous location offers visitors a unique opportunity to see these majestic creatures in their natural habitat.
  3. Lobeke National Park. This is one of the largest national parks in Africa. The park is known for its unique representatives of nature. For instance, including elephants, buffalo and various species of primates.

Bonus is a location for souvenir shopping. It is the 17th mile market in the city of Buea. This market offers a wide range of goods including traditional African textiles, ceramics, handmade wooden sculptures and jewellery made from local materials. Also, here you will find unique souvenirs reflecting the culture and art of the region.

Top 5 Interesting Facts about Cameroon 

  1. Makossa. It is a musical genre that originated here and has become popular throughout Africa. Makossa combines elements of traditional music and modern rhythms to assemble a unique sound.
  2. Chauffeur-driven car hire system. In Cameroon, it is common practice to rent cars with a driver. This is due to the fact that many roads are in poor condition.
  3. Wettest place in Africa. Part of Cameroon’s territory is the wettest place on the continent. Accordingly, this creates one and only space of conditions for the development of nature.
  4. Diversity of cultures. Cameroon is native land to more than 250 different peoples. Meanwhile, this makes it one of the most culturally diverse states in Africa.
